pfc no-drop queues
Configure the port queues that still function as no-drop queues for lossless traffic.
Syntax
pfc no-drop queues queue-range
To remove the no-drop port queues, use the no pfc no-drop queues command.
Parameters
queue-range
Enter the queue range. Separate the queue values with a comma; specify a priority
range with a dash; for example, pfc no-drop queues 1,3 or pfc no-drop
queues 7 or pfc no-drop queues 0,7. The range is from 0 to 3.
Defaults No lossless queues are configured.
Command Modes INTERFACE

Usage
Information
When you configure lossless queues on an interface, PFC priority configuration is not allowed on the
dcb-map profile applied on the interface.
The maximum number of lossless queues globally supported on the switch is two.

Before configuring the port queues to function as no-drop queues, you must first apply the dcb-map
map with pfc mode off. To apply the dcb-map with pfc mode off, use the following commands:
dcb-map pfcoff and no pfc mode on.
